From Curious to Committed: How Tower Gardening Changed Our Family

4/27/2026

0 Comments

 
Back in 2012, our family made an investment that ended up creating a big ripple in our lives, we brought a Tower Garden into our home.

At the time, we were simply curious. We wanted a way to grow our own food, to feel a little more connected to what we were eating, and honestly… to see if we could actually keep plants alive (no small feat for many of us!). What we didn’t expect was how much it would impact not just what we ate, but how we lived.

At first, it was exciting just to watch things grow. Seeds turning into leafy greens right before our eyes felt almost magical. There’s something incredibly grounding about witnessing that process up close, especially for kids. It became more than a garden; it became a daily touchpoint. A moment to check in, water, observe, and appreciate.

And then came the real shift: we started eating what we grew. Fresh lettuce, herbs, tomatoes, harvested right from our own tower, began showing up in our meals. Food tasted better. It felt better. And somehow, when you’ve had a hand in growing it, you value it differently. There’s pride in that. There’s connection.

Over time, this simple system quietly shaped our habits. We became more intentional about what we put on our plates. The kids became more curious about food. Conversations changed. It wasn’t about “eat your veggies” anymore, it was, “look what we grew.”

And beyond the food, it gave us something else that’s hard to measure but easy to feel: a sense of empowerment. The ability to grow your own food, no matter the season, no matter the space, shifts your mindset. It reminds you that small actions at home can have a meaningful impact.

Looking back, bringing a Tower Garden into our lives in 2012 was one of those decisions that didn’t seem monumental at the time—but absolutely became one.
